Pump oxygenator system

A pump oxygenator system is a medical device used during heart surgery to temporarily take over the functions of the heart and lungs. It pumps blood out of the body, adding oxygen and removing carbon dioxide, then circulates the now-oxygenated blood back into the bloodstream. This ensures that the body's tissues receive oxygen and nutrients while the heart is stopped or repaired. The system combines a pump to move blood and an oxygenator to enrich it with oxygen, allowing surgeons to operate safely on the heart without cutting off blood flow to the entire body.
